Types of Jhumkas We Offer
- Traditional Jhumkas — Bell-shaped designs with ghungroo drops, filigree work, and temple-inspired motifs
- Oxidised Jhumkas — Vintage-finish jhumkas with dark patina, tribal engravings, and antique appeal
- Kashmiri Jhumkas — Extended-length jhumkas with chain attachments and multi-tier dome construction
- Lightweight Jhumkas — Hollow or thin-metal designs for all-day comfort without sacrificing the jhumka silhouette
- Stone-Set Jhumkas — Silver jhumkas adorned with coloured stones, pearls, and mirror work for festive occasions

Styling Tips for Jhumka Earrings
Pair large oxidised jhumkas with sarees, anarkalis, and ethnic wear for maximum traditional impact. For casual outings, smaller silver jhumkas complement kurtas, palazzo pants, and even denim. When wearing statement jhumkas, keep necklaces minimal or skip them entirely — let the earrings command attention. Tie your hair in a bun or side plait to showcase the full beauty of the design.

What is the difference between jhumkas and regular earrings?
Jhumkas have a distinctive dome or bell shape that tapers downward, often with small danglers or ghungroo bells at the bottom. Regular earrings can be any shape including studs, hoops, or drops. The jhumka silhouette is uniquely Indian and has been worn for centuries across South Asia.

Which face shape suits jhumka earrings?
Jhumkas are flattering on most face shapes. Oval and heart-shaped faces look especially elegant with medium to large jhumkas. Round faces benefit from elongated Kashmiri-style jhumkas that add vertical lines. Square faces suit rounded jhumka designs that soften angular features.
Can I wear jhumkas with Western outfits?
Absolutely. Smaller oxidised jhumkas pair beautifully with solid-colour tops, maxi dresses, and boho-style outfits. The key is keeping the rest of your jewellery minimal so the jhumkas stand out as the statement piece. They add an ethnic edge to any Western look.
How to care for oxidised jhumka earrings?
Store in a dry, airtight pouch when not wearing. Wipe gently with a soft cloth after each use. Avoid contact with water, perfume, and chemicals. The oxidised finish naturally evolves over time, developing a richer patina that enhances the vintage aesthetic.
